Farmers in Akure North cry out for help as bandit attacks escalate

By Dayo Thomas –

Agricnews Digest has received distressing reports from farmers in Akure North, Ondo State, who are living in fear of bandit attacks. Speaking on condition of anonymity, the farmers revealed that their lives are under constant threat as bandits continue to attack and kill people in their farms.

“We are living in fear, and it’s getting worse by the day,” one farmer said. “We can’t go to our farms without worrying about our safety. We’ve lost count of the number of people killed by these bandits.”

The farmers appealed to the government and security agencies to intervene and put an end to the attacks. “We need protection to farm and feed our families. We can’t continue to live like this,” another farmer added.

The plight of Akure North farmers is a stark reminder of the security challenges facing Nigeria’s agricultural sector. With many farmers abandoning their farms due to insecurity, food production and the nation’s economy are likely to suffer.
